
Dr. Robert Wall M.D.
Neurologist | Electrodiagnostic Medicine
1481 South Macon Court Aurora Colorado, 80012About
General Neurology for the United States Navy. Retired 2009.
Developed the Sleep Disporders Laboratory at Naval Hospital San Diego 1997.
Developed the Traumatic Brain Injury Clinic at Naval Hospital Camp Pendleton 2006 to 2009.
